Patent number: 10380502Abstract: A calculation apparatus includes a feature vector acquisition unit for acquiring a feature vector that corresponds to each alternative of a plurality of choice sets; an absolute evaluation calculation unit for calculating an absolute evaluation vector that represents an absolute evaluation of alternatives independent of a combination of the plurality of alternatives; a relativized-matrix calculation unit for calculating a relativized matrix that represents relative evaluations of the plurality of alternatives in a choice set; and a relative evaluation calculation unit for calculating a relative evaluation vector that represents a relative evaluation of each alternative of the plurality of alternatives from a product of multiplying the relativized matrix by the absolute evaluation vector. The calculation apparatus can predict intransitive choices of a person who exhibits intransitive preferences.Type: GrantFiled: November 20, 2015Date of Patent: August 13, 2019Assignee: INTERNATIONAL BUSINESS MACHINES CORPORATIONInventor: Rikiya Takahashi

Patent number: 10121156Abstract: An analysis device including a substitution unit for substituting each event in an impulse-like event series with rectangular windows; a dividing unit for dividing the event series timewise at least at one transition point in the rectangular windows; a state vector generation unit for generating a state vector corresponding to the state of the rectangular windows in response to each of the divided time periods; and an analysis unit for performing Poisson regression using the state vectors corresponding to the time periods. A method comprising computer-executable steps is provided that substitutes each event in the inputted event series with rectangular windows; divides the event series timewise at least at one transition point in the rectangular pulses; generates a state vector corresponding to the state of the rectangular pulses in response to each of the divided time periods; and performs a Poisson regression using the state vectors corresponding to the time periods.Type: GrantFiled: November 19, 2013Date of Patent: November 6, 2018Assignee: International Business Machines CorporationInventor: Rikiya Takahashi

Patent number: 9857775Abstract: A method applied to a computer that determines a situation of a system includes the steps of: receiving measurement data from each of a plurality of measurement targets in the system; computing a plurality of sets of anomaly values based on the measurement data and a predetermined computation algorithm according to a plurality of classifications corresponding to a plurality of properties of each measurement target; and determining the situation of the system based on the sets of anomaly values and a predetermined determination algorithm.Type: GrantFiled: December 15, 2011Date of Patent: January 2, 2018Assignee: INTERNATIONAL BUSINESS MACHINES CORPORATIONInventors: Karim Hamzaoui, Shohei Hido, Shoko Suzuki, Rikiya Takahashi, Sachiko Yoshihama

Publication number: 20170046726Abstract: An information processing device which selects a set of items to be recommended for a user out of a set of items. The information processing device includes: (a) a selection unit which: (i) calculates priority which is high in the case of a high score of an item itself and low in the case of a high degree of similarity to another selected item with respect to each of the plurality of items, and (ii) selects a set of items out of the plurality of items on the basis of the priority; and (ii) an output unit which outputs each item included in the selected set of items as an item to be presented to the user.Type: ApplicationFiled: November 1, 2016Publication date: February 16, 2017Inventors: Hideyuki Mizuta, Rikiya Takahashi

Publication number: 20150294226Abstract: An information processing apparatus optimizes an action in a transition model in which a number of objects in each state transits according to the action. A cost constraint acquisition unit acquires multiple cost constraints including one that constrains a total cost of the action over at multiple timings and/or multiple states. A processing unit assumes action distribution in each state at each timing as a decision variable in an optimization problem and maximizes an objective function subtracting a term based on an error between an actual number of objects with the action in each state at each timing and an estimated number of objects in each state at each timing based on state transition by the transition model, from a total reward in a whole period, satisfying the multiple cost constraints. An output unit outputs the action distribution in each state at each timing that maximizes the objective function.Type: ApplicationFiled: June 24, 2015Publication date: October 15, 2015Inventors: Hideyuki Mizuta, Rikiya Takahashi, Takayuki Yoshizumi

Publication number: 20150294350Abstract: An information processing apparatus that optimizes a policy in a transition model in which the number of targeted objects in each state transits according to the policy includes a cost constraint acquisition unit configured to acquire a cost constraint that constrains a total cost of the policy; a mass policy setting unit configured to set the number of objects targeted by a mass policy in each state, based on the predefined number of objects to belong to each state and a reach rate at which the mass policy reaches to an object, with respect to the mass policy collectively executed for the object in two or more states; and a processing unit configured to assume the reach rate of the mass policy as a variable of an optimization and maximize an objective function based on a total reward in a whole period while satisfying the cost constraint.Type: ApplicationFiled: June 24, 2015Publication date: October 15, 2015Inventors: Hideyuki Mizuta, Rikiya Takahashi, Takayuki Yoshizumi

Patent number: 8805841Abstract: A method for clustering a plurality of data items stored in a computer includes calculating, with the computer, a plurality of components comprising kernels based on a distribution that gives similarity between the data items, wherein a non-negative mixture weight is assigned to each of the kernels; preparing a set of active components that are composed of subscripts of the mixture weights; applying operations to the set of active components; and determining whether the mixture weight has converged, and if not converged yet, reapplying the operations to the set of components, and if the mixture weight has converged, clustering the data items based on the mixture weight.Type: GrantFiled: October 12, 2011Date of Patent: August 12, 2014Assignee: International Business Machines CorporationInventor: Rikiya Takahashi

Publication number: 20130282341Abstract: A method for estimating a probability density function of values in a link from a distribution of values associated with the link in graph data includes fitting, with a processor, according to the link, a basis function representing the distribution of values in the link; determining an importance scalar representing a weighting of values associated with the link on the basis of a plurality of basis functions corresponding to the link by optimizing a predetermined objective function; and providing the probability density function corresponding to the link by mixing the basis functions with the importance scalar so as to interpolate the basis functions between links similar to the link in the graph data.Type: ApplicationFiled: February 28, 2013Publication date: October 24, 2013Inventor: Rikiya Takahashi

Patent number: 8138974Abstract: A location estimation method using label propagation. The achieved location estimation method is robust to variations in radio signal strengths and is highly accurate by using the q-norm (0<q<1), especially, for calculating the similarities among radio signal strength vectors. The accuracy in location estimation is further improved by putting more importance on the time-series similarities. Specifically, the time-series similarity is calculated by using time-series values indicating the temporal order of radio signal strengths during the measurement. If the time-series similarity is larger than the similarity between the radio signal strength vectors, the time-series similarity is preferentially used. The exponential attenuation function can also be used for calculating the similarities, instead of the q norm (0<q<1).Type: GrantFiled: October 24, 2008Date of Patent: March 20, 2012Assignee: International Busines Machines CorporationInventors: Shohei Hido, Tsuyoshi Ide, Hisashi Kashima, Shoko Suzuki, Akira Tajima, Rikiya Takahashi, Toshihiro Takahashi, Yuta Tsuboi

Patent number: 7846290Abstract: A method for manufacturing a friction plate in which a plurality of frictional material segments are adhered to a substantially annular core plate. The method previously registers the frictional material segments to adhesion positions, and presses the core plate to which adhesive agent is applied and the frictional segments to perform temporary adhesion. Further, an apparatus for manufacturing a friction plate in which a plurality of frictional material segments are adhered to a substantially annular core plate. The apparatus comprises a member for registering the frictional material segments while holding the frictional material segments in a state arranged in the adhesion positions.Type: GrantFiled: March 13, 2008Date of Patent: December 7, 2010Assignee: NSK-Warner K.K.Inventors: Satoru Anma, Rikiya Takahashi
